Hand out to the students the Yeast Bread Crossword puzzle that they can work on if they have time during the hour. They can use the classroom textbook and their notes as resources in completing the puzzle.
Hand out the lab planning sheets and the recipe for the Pretzels. (If this lab is used as an introduction to yeast breads, refer to the study sheet for some basic information about yeast breads and working with yeast before lab. If this lab is used as another lab experience to work with yeast in preparing yeast breads, then you can begin with the lab.) Go over and explain how to prepare the pretzels.
The students will need to set their table, eat and clean up before leaving.
